At its core, the documentary film seeks to mediate reality through a personal point of view. While commercial cinema often relies on "perceptual realism"—using high-tech cues to make fictional worlds feel physically real—documentaries rely on , connecting viewers to the historical world through research, archival footage, and authentic interviews.

The entertainment landscape is currently undergoing its most radical transformation since the invention of sound. Documentaries are tracking this evolution in real-time, capturing how tech monopolies, algorithms, and artificial intelligence are rewriting the rules of Hollywood.
